Product Overview

The Analog Devices AD826ARZ-REEL7 is a dual high-speed voltage feedback operational amplifier with 50 MHz unity-gain bandwidth, 350 V/µs slew rate, and 70 ns 0.01% settling time. It can drive unlimited capacitive loads and delivers 50 mA minimum output current per amplifier. Supplied in an 8-pin SOIC package, it operates from +5 V to ±15 V over -40°C to 85°C.

The AD826ARZ-REEL7 from Analog Devices is a dual, high-speed voltage feedback operational amplifier that excels in applications requiring unity-gain stability, high output drive capability, and the ability to drive heavy capacitive loads. With 50 MHz bandwidth and 350 V/µs slew rate, the AD826 is suitable for many high-speed applications including video, CATV, copiers, LCDs, image scanners, and fax machines. The device features high output current drive of 50 mA minimum per amplifier and can drive unlimited capacitive loads without instability. The low power supply current of 15 mA maximum for both amplifiers makes it suitable for power-sensitive applications such as video cameras and portable instrumentation. The AD826 operates from a single +5 V supply (achieving 25 MHz bandwidth) up to ±15 V dual supplies.

The AD826 uses a voltage feedback architecture consisting of a degenerated NPN differential pair input stage driving matched PNP transistors in a folded-cascode gain stage. The output buffer stage employs emitter followers in a Class-AB configuration that delivers the necessary current to the load while maintaining low distortion levels. A key innovation is the internal compensation capacitor (CF) in the output stage that mitigates the effect of capacitive loads. With low capacitive loads, CF is bootstrapped and does not contribute to overall compensation. As capacitive loading increases, the output stage pole reduces the gain, partially engaging CF as additional compensation capacitance, which reduces the unity-gain bandwidth but maintains stability. This self-adjusting mechanism allows the AD826 to drive any value of capacitive load without oscillation, a feature rarely available in high-speed op amps.
